What the Search Phrase Usually Signals

The phrase “o khuda mp3 song download” combines a title-like expression with a format and access request. “Khuda” is a word used in several cultural and linguistic settings to refer to God, and it can carry spiritual, intimate, pleading, reflective, or devotional associations depending on the listener and the song’s actual wording.

That emotional openness helps explain why people may search for a title phrase rather than a full release name. A listener might remember a repeated hook, a feeling, a language cue, or a scene connected with hearing music. None of those clues, however, verify a recording’s ownership, artist credit, release status, lyrics, or availability.

Genre Background and Listening Cues

Without verified release information, it is not responsible to label a particular “O Khuda” recording with a definite genre. Still, listeners can use a few broad cues when exploring music with emotionally charged or spiritually inflected language.

Listen for the relationship between voice and arrangement. A close, exposed vocal delivery may make a song feel confessional. Spacious production, sustained chords, choral textures, or restrained percussion can create a contemplative atmosphere. More pronounced rhythm, melodic repetition, or dramatic vocal rises may shift the feeling toward pop, cinematic balladry, dance-oriented music, or another style.

Genre is not merely a label. It is a listening framework that helps audiences notice how a song carries emotion. Ask whether the beat encourages movement or stillness, whether the melody resolves or lingers, and whether the performance sounds direct, theatrical, conversational, or prayerful.

Listener Interpretation: A Respectful Approach

A strong interpretation begins with what can actually be heard and verified, not with assumptions about the performer’s private intent. Listeners can describe musical details—tempo, vocal intensity, instrumental space, repetition, or emotional contrast—while keeping conclusions appropriately tentative.

For example, instead of declaring that a song is definitively about one experience, a listener might say that its vocal phrasing *can suggest* yearning, or that its arrangement *may invite* a reflective mood. This approach respects both the work and the range of audiences who may encounter it differently.

If you are building a playlist, discussing the song with friends, or writing about it, distinguish between three levels of statement:

  • Verified facts: information confirmed through an official artist or release source.
  • Listener interpretation: your response to the sound, title, mood, or performance.
  • Open questions: details that require checking, such as artist credit, version, availability, or download rights.

This distinction is particularly important for songs with spiritually resonant wording, since listeners may attach deep personal significance to language that others understand in a different cultural context.
